NeuroEPO is a new, patented recombinant human erythropoietin (rhEPO) formulation with specific molecular modifications. Standard medical EPO is a glycoprotein hormone that primarily stimulates red blood cell production in the bone marrow, making it a frontline treatment for various forms of anemia. NeuroEPO is distinguished by its , which has two critical effects: it drastically reduces the compound's hematopoietic (red blood cell-boosting) activity while simultaneously concentrating its neuroprotective properties.
